Aserto
Aserto helps developers build secure applications. It makes it easy to add fine-grained, policy-based, real-time access control to your applications and APIs.
Aserto handles all the heavy lifting required to achieve secure, scalable, high-performance access management. It offers blazing-fast authorization of a local library coupled with a centralized control plane for managing policies, user attributes, relationship data, and decision logs. And it comes with everything you need to implement RBAC or fine-grained authorization models, such as ABAC, and ReBAC. Casbin
Casbin is an open-source authorization library that supports various access control models, including Access Control Lists (ACL), Role-Based Access Control (RBAC), and Attribute-Based Access Control (ABAC). It is implemented in multiple programming languages such as Golang, Java, C/C++, Node.js, JavaScript, PHP, Laravel, Python, .NET (C#), Delphi, Rust, Ruby, Swift (Objective-C), Lua (OpenResty), Dart (Flutter), and Elixir, providing a consistent API across different platforms. Casbin abstracts access control models into configuration files based on the PERM metamodel, allowing developers to switch or upgrade authorization mechanisms by simply modifying configurations. It offers flexible policy storage options, supporting various datab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, Oracle, MongoDB, Redis, and AWS S3. The library also features a role manager to handle RBAC role hierarchies and supports filtered policy management for efficient enforcement.

Passwork
Passwork provides an advantage of effective teamwork with corporate passwords in a totally safe environment. Employees can quickly access all their passwords, while the rights and actions are closely supervised and managed by local system administrators.
All data is encrypted using the AES-256 algorithm while being securely stored on your server and managed solely by system administrators. Passwork runs on PHP and MongoDB and can be installed on Windows and Linux, with or without Docker.
